The Mariposa Energy Project is a 199.6 MW natural gas-fired power plant located in Alameda County, California. The plant began operating in 2012 and consists of four natural gas-fired combustion turbine generators. It is owned and operated by Diamond Generating Corporation. The plant is connected to the California Independent System Operator (CAISO) balancing authority, within the Western Electricity Coordinating Council (WECC) NERC region.
In its latest year of reported generation, the Mariposa Energy Project produced 29,135 MWh of electricity, operating at a capacity factor of 1.7%. The plant ranks 51st out of 76 power plants in California and 749th out of 945 plants nationally.
